About Viridis Research

Viridis develops electro-oxidation technology to eliminate organic pollutants from water sources, specifically targeting toxic dyes and microplastics in textile wastewater. This approach addresses the critical issue of water pollution, ensuring access to clean and usable water for households, industries, and municipalities.

Company Description

Problem

The textile industry generates significant water pollution through the release of toxic dyes, microplastics, and other organic pollutants in its wastewater. Conventional treatment methods often fail to completely remove these contaminants, leading to environmental damage and health risks. This necessitates more effective and sustainable solutions for wastewater treatment in the textile sector.

Solution

Viridis provides electrochemical oxidation (electroxidation) technology designed to eliminate organic pollutants from water sources, specifically targeting textile wastewater. Their systems address both upstream and downstream pollution challenges by removing contaminants such as toxic dyes, surfactants, microplastics, and other persistent organic compounds. The electroxidation process breaks down these pollutants, transforming them into less harmful substances and enabling water circularity. Viridis offers solutions for both industrial wastewater treatment and household greywater recycling, promoting sustainable water management practices across various sectors.
